1891 · Bureau of American Ethnology
Sacred Formulas of the Cherokees
Documented from the notebooks of Cherokee practitioner Swimmer in the late 19th century, this is the primary ethnographic record of Cherokee ceremonial knowledge in written form. Mooney's fieldwork for the Bureau of American Ethnology preserved a body of linguistic and cultural material that would otherwise have been lost. An essential reference for Cherokee studies and the history of Indigenous documentation in North America.
